Pep Guardiola hails Bastian Schweinsteiger

Pep Guardiola believes that Bastian Schweinsteiger is a key player for Bayern Munich and is glad to have him back from injury.

Bayern Munich head coach Pep Guardiola has praised the abilities of his vice captain Bastian Schweinsteiger after the German international made his return from injury in the 5-0 win against Hamburger SV.

Guardiola said that Schweinsteiger would need a few more games to get back to full match fitness, but is an "important" member of the Bayern team.

"Bastian is an outstanding player, and he played very well against Hamburg, although he still needs a few more games," Guardiola told Bundesliga.com. "The fans' reaction showed us how important he is for the team."

Bayern's next game is on Saturday afternoon against relegation-threatened Freiburg.
